Li Peng Meets With Macao Chief Executive

����NPC Chairman Li Peng met in Beijing May 25 with Edmund Ho Hau Wah, who has been appointed the first Chief Executive of the Macao Special Administrative Region (SAR).

����Li said that the appointment means that Macao will enter a new period under the "one country, two systems" and "Macao people governing Macao" principles and with a high degree of autonomy, as written in the Basic Law of the Macao SAR.

����Li said that the Basic Law will be fully implemented after the regional government is established on December 20 and that the NPC will support the Chief Executive in his work.

����Ho said that he will work hard for the successful implementation of the "one country, two systems" policy and for the long-term stability and development of Macao. (Xinhua)
